> Please fix your header
> 	List-Id: Patches for autoconf, the GNU build system <autoconf-patches.gnu.org>
> 
> to comply with RFC2919 and RFC822/RFC2822. You use a forbidden special ','.
> 
> Either quote it
> 	List-Id: "Patches for autoconf, the GNU build system" <autoconf-patches.gnu.org>
> 
> or use smth like
> 	List-Id: Patches for autoconf - the GNU build system <autoconf-patches.gnu.org>
> .

I used your latter suggestion and went with a string that did not need
any quoting.
